Evaluation of incentive mechanisms for distributed solar power generation in San Juan, Argentina

The province of San Juan in Argentina presents significant values of solar radiation that stimulate the development of distributed solar photovoltaic generation. Moreover, National Law 27.424 proposes Net Billing as an incentive mechanism for renewable energy sources. This work analyzes the profitability of photovoltaic systems in the residential sector under current electricity costs and fare conditions. The results show that, on average, the leveled cost of photovoltaic generation is 20% higher than the average value of the fares for residential users. It is necessary to apply incentive mechanisms as proposed in Law 27.424 to achieve grid parity. The Net Metering mechanism would be more profitable for photovoltaic system owners but could adversely impact utility incomes.
